TL;DR
AtomStack A24 Pro 1064nm is the fiber-marking variant without the diode side — for users who only need metal/plastic marking in a small footprint, not wood cutting.
What this machine is for
Compact fiber marking for metal and engineered plastics.

Beginner notes
Pick the hybrid A24 Pro if you also engrave wood regularly.
Pro tips
Rotary and fixture quality matter more than raw wattage for rings and pens.
